Important Affordable Care Act Deadline Tomorrow!

There is only one day left! You MUST enroll or renew your plan by tomorrow, December 18th at 11:59 pm, for coverage and financial assistance under the Affordable Care Act (ACA) for January 1, 2015 onward. If you enrolled through Maryland Health Connection in 2014 and do not reapply by tomorrow night, any financial help you received this year will end on December 31, 2014 and your January bill may be higher.

Open enrollment under the ACA will be available until February 15, 2015. AAHI in the News: Mammograms

A mammogram is an x-ray picture of the breast and helps look for early signs of breast cancer. According to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ention, regular mammograms are the best screening tools doctors have to find breast cancer early - sometimes up to three years before it can be felt.

As part of AAHI's cultural media campaign and to promote the importance of getting screened regularly, we partnered with several local Asian newspapers to publish in-language articles about mammograms. Please click on the thumbnails below to read a full-sized version of the published articles!

The Affordable Care Act & HealthConnect Now!

Date: Saturday, December 6, 2014
Time: 9:00 am - 4:00 pm (Silver Spring) and 10:00 am - 2:00 pm (Fort Washington)
Location: Silver Spring Civic Center, 1 Veterans Place, Silver Spring, MD 20910 and Southern Reg Tech & Rec Complex, 7007 Bock Road, Fort Washington, MD 20744
Cost: Free, but registration is encouraged. To register, please visit http://goo.gl/w12wgO or call 855-642-8572.

Open enrollment under the Affordable Care Act is a 90-day period, which re-opened on November 15, 2014. If you enrolled last year through Maryland Health Connection, you must re-enroll by December 18, 2014 to continue coverage with financial assistance for January 2015 onward. If you do not enroll by December 18th, your current coverage will continue but with no financial assistance.

The Capital Region Health Connector will host two HealthConnect Now! enrollment events in Montgomery County and Prince George's County. You will have the opportunity to receive in-person enrollment assistance to shop, select, and enroll in health coverage that fits your needs and budget. Recap: E.C.H.O Workshop #8 - Mental Health in Our Communities II

On November 4th, AAHI, in partnership with the African American Health Program and the Latino Health Initiative, hosted our "Mental Health in Our Communities II" Workshop. This was the eighth installment in our Empowering Community Health Organizations (E.C.H.O.) Project, which provides practical and professional training workshops designed to build the capacity and sustainability of community organizations.


The workshop was led by two speakers. The first speaker was the Senior Program Director at the Mental Health Association of Montgomery County, who gave a presentation on mental health, its connection to the mind and body, as well as tools to help overcome cultural barriers and challenges. In addition, the Manager of the Montgomery County Department of Health and Human Services Access to Behavioral Health provided a brief overview of support services and resources in Montgomery County.


After the presentation, there was a small group exercise that gave attendees the opportunity to discuss mental health within the context of a specific community. The night concluded with a brief question and answer session.


Over 100 attendees, representing about 50 organizations from the community, attended our workshop!
